Output fc643e9529acc137bd246f219b8aa17a1f66f4fdce5a56d920c41c5690005b73:0

value
500010059
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 02a9dea6b673b60a2b6e0130aa40c6e6c9488ae7 OP_EQUALVERIFY OP_CHECKSIG
address
1F5r96K6ryPmgKVAMzURQKyCfvjQEPbQ1
transaction
fc643e9529acc137bd246f219b8aa17a1f66f4fdce5a56d920c41c5690005b73
confirmations
530858
spent
true